3种陆生贝类不同组织酯酶(EST)同工酶比较分析 被引量:1

The EST isozyme analysis on different tissues of three species of terrestrial mollusk

摘要 采用聚丙烯酰胺电泳法分析了陆生贝类扁平毛蜗牛(Trichochloritis submissa),宽盘大脐蜗牛(Aegistaplatyomphala),褐色圈螺(Plectopylis fimbriosa)3个种成体内肝脏、外套膜、足组织的酯酶同工酶,共得到17条基本谱带,其中有2条为3个种共有。3种陆生贝类相应的酶带有明显种属差异,且都表现出组织特异性。以酶谱为性状,对其进行聚类分析,结果显示扁平毛蜗牛与宽盘大脐蜗牛的亲缘关系较近。 The EST isozyme of three different tissues of Trichochloritis submissa,Aegista platyomphala and Plectopylis fimbriosa were analyzed by polypropylene gel electrophoresis(PAGE).From experiment we got 17 bands in total and 2 common bands of three species.The results showed that there are differences in bands Rf s of EST isozyme for different species,and showed the tissue specificity.Using cluster analysis for bands,the results showed that Trichochloritis submissa and Aegista platyomphala have near relative relation.
